Orthokeratology (Ortho-K) is a non-surgical vision correction method that involves wearing specially designed rigid gas-permeable contact lenses overnight to temporarily reshape the cornea, improving vision without the need for glasses or daytime contact lenses. The numbers are a measure of the optical power of the lenses in diopters. Essentially a positive number increases the optical power of your eye (which corrects for farsightedness) and a negative number decreases the optical power of your eye (which corrects for nearsightedness).
Children should have their first eye exam by 6 months, but we begin seeing patients at age 3. Early eye exams are essential to detect and prevent issues like lazy eye and eye turns, ensuring healthy vision development.
